For individuals that live in even more country areas and also without accessibility to public water systems, understanding just how your well water system is functioning as well as knowing the health and wellness of your water is important to your total health and wellness and health.


Food preparation, cleaning, laundry, horticulture, cold showers and hot baths you utilize water for a great deal of household activities. But having a well water system calls for a little bit a lot more alertness to make certain that water is risk-free to consume and use on your skin. Well Water Testing. "Depending on the age of your residence, you can have old copper or lead piping, as well as well water can leach various other things from that piping," mentions Dr


In little amounts, nitrates are harmless, but when they're ingested, they get transformed to nitrites, which can be hazardous when eaten in big quantities. Due to the fact that of the number of nitrates discovered in plant foods and pet waste, unattended well water can lead to poisoning as well as cause problems with your body's capacity to relocate oxygen from one part of your body to one more.

Due to this, Dr. Modlo suggests having your well water checked each year (typically in the springtime) to examine acidity levels, bacteria growth as well as the existence of various other impurities. "I would certainly recommend screening your water as part of your house inspection if you're getting a brand-new residence before you take over the building, and after that you'll wish to evaluate on a routine basis concerning when a year," he recommends.




Water must be tasteless and also rejuvenating. If it tastes rank or sour, you desire to avoid drinking it. "If you have hard water with excessive magnesium, calcium and also salts, those are mosting likely to dry your skin as well as that can additionally block several of your pores," Dr. Modlo includes.


In some cases, you may also experience mineral spots or less water stress in your house. If you have difficulty with difficult water, a water softener can remove the excess minerals. In the case of flooding or various other all-natural calamities, a water major break or sewage system overflow, local authorities are in charge of notifying affected areas of feasible contaminations and also whether you ought to steam your water initially prior to ingesting it.


"You wish to steam water for at the very least 1 minute (as well as longer if you're over an elevation of 6,0007,000 feet) to take away some of the possible bacteria that have polluted your water," explains Dr. Modlo, "yet if it has useful reference hazardous chemicals or contaminated materials in it, you're not going to have the ability to steam that off." If you ever see a modification in the color, odor or taste of your well water, you can call your local health department or a state-certified laboratory to assist in testing for feasible contaminants so you can repair the underlying reason.
